Motivation, learning and well-being in digital era

Minds Hub

Minds Hub Research Group at the University of Helsinki study motivation, learning and well-being in changing global context. We investigate students' school careers and development across compulsory comprehensive education to higher education and subsequent transition to working life. Our aim is to understand how digitalization, diversity, inequality and stress affect youth development at large. We are responsible for four Academy of Finland funded research projects and promoting new data collection methods. We collect and integrate longitudinal, physiological and situational data. The Director is Professor Katariina Salmela-Aro.
